مكالمات غير متزامنة، استطلاع مقابل Webhooks

عندما يتم تحديث البيانات على جانب النظام الخارجي، من المهم تلقيها في الوقت المحدد وبدون تحميل غير ضروري على الخادم. تستخدم عمليات دمج API نهجين لهذا الغرض: الاقتراع وخطابات الويب. نحن ندعم كلتا الطريقتين ونساعدك في اختيار الأفضل للمهمة: الاقتراع المنتظم مناسب للبيانات غير الحرجة، وخطابات الويب مناسبة للاستجابة الفورية للأحداث.

تتيح لك هذه المرونة توفير الموارد وزيادة الاستقرار والاستجابة بسرعة لأي تغييرات في النظام الخارجي.


مقارنة النُهج

الطريقةمزاياميزات التطبيق
الاقتراعالتنفيذ البسيط، لا يتطلب تلقي الطلباتاقتراع API الخارجي في فترة زمنية محددة
شبكات الويبرد فعل فوري، لا حركة مرور إضافيةيرسل النظام الخارجي الإخطار نفسه

كيف ننفذ

الاقتراع عبر CRON، قوائم الانتظار، المهام المؤجلة
  • خطوط الويب مع نقاط نهاية آمنة، التحقق من صحة التوقيع (HMAC)
  • التحكم في فترة الاقتراع، تكرار التفريغ
  • الأمان: الرموز، تصفية بروتوكول الإنترنت، إعادة تجربة الأخطاء
  • أحداث قطع الأشجار: من، متى، مع الحمولة والنتيجة

أمثلة حدث Webhook

إشعار إيصال الدفع
  • إقرار شركة KYC أو تسجيلها
  • نهاية الجلسة، الرهان، الفوز
  • تحديث لاعب أو توازن
  • حالات تسليم البريد الإلكتروني/الرسائل القصيرة

مزايا الإدماج

رد الفعل السريع على الأحداث الخارجية
  • لا يوجد حمل زائد لواجهة برمجة التطبيقات مع طلبات غير ضرورية
  • إعادة تجربة مرنة/إعداد مهلة
  • التوافق مع مقدمي الخدمات (Stripe، Telegram، Meta، إلخ)
  • إضفاء الطابع المركزي على منطق معالجة الإشعارات

حيثما كانت ذات أهمية خاصة

منصات الدفع والبوابات المالية
  • منصات iGaming مع أحداث في الوقت الفعلي
  • خدمات التسويق وتكامل البريد الإلكتروني
  • نظم ذات كميات كبيرة من البيانات المتغيرة ديناميكيًا

الاقتراع أو Webhooks - اختر الأفضل للمهمة. نحن ننفذ كلا المخططين مع حماية موثوقة وقطع الأشجار والهندسة المعمارية القابلة للتطوير بحيث تعمل واجهة برمجة التطبيقات الخاصة بك بكفاءة ودون تأخير.

تواصل معنا

يرجى ملء النموذج أدناه وسنرد عليك في أقرب وقت ممكن.

البريد الإلكتروني:

info@jackcode.io

support@jackcode.io